Week 41 creativity & development

For Week 41, let’s try to carve out time each day to engage in artistic activities: painting, writing, or playing a musical instrument. Experiment with new techniques to broaden your creative horizon. For educational development, set specific learning goals—like mastering a new language, skill, or subject area. Utilize online resources, such as courses, tutorials, and educational videos. Balance screen time with offline learning through reading books or practicing hands-on projects. We can stay curious and challenge ourselves daily. Keeping a journal to document our progress and reflect on your journey is a good way to stay engaged and see progress grow.
